Posted in

Software Engineer – IOS App Development

Software Engineer – IOS App Development

CompanyThe Washington Post
LocationWashington, DC, USA
Salary$74200 – $123600
TypeFull-Time
DegreesBachelor’s
Experience LevelEntry Level/New Grad, Junior

Requirements

  • Bachelor’s degree in Computer Science, engineering or related technical field or equivalent experience.
  • Strong grasp of computer science fundamentals, operating systems, algorithms, data structure, design principles.
  • Excellent verbal/written communication and collaboration skills.
  • Strong problem-solving skills.
  • Experience working with or prototyping with Apple SDKs
  • Experience with Swift.
  • Experience with Version Control principles, preferably using Git and Pull Requests
  • Familiarity with Agile/Scrum methodologies
  • Experience with testing and quality assurance practices including unit testing and code documentation.

Responsibilities

  • Design and develop advanced applications for iOS and related platforms.
  • Collaborate with cross-functional teams to define API contracts, design and ship new features.
  • Design high-level mobile solutions to meet product requirements and following established development methodologies and standards.
  • Understand the complexities of and help integrate different third-party SDKs
  • Identify, troubleshoot, and solve complex problems
  • Participate in agile software development practices and peer/code reviews.
  • Unit-test code for robustness, including edge cases, usability and general reliability
  • Stay on top of latest technologies/ mobile trends and recommend appropriate design solutions.

Preferred Qualifications

    No preferred qualifications provided.